Abstract

This video shows a prototype system for the visualization of time-vary ing volume data of one or several variables as they occur in scientific and engineering applications. It partitions the data dimensions on the client side into a 3D viewer for iso-surfaces and a 2D control plane where each point selects a particular iso-surface in 3D.
